SWBP我查不到这句汇编的意思

[复制链接]
4563|20
 楼主| shimx 发表于 2017-12-17 16:20 | 显示全部楼层 |阅读模式
我用的是TMS320c6747,我的例程里面的.h文件有这么一句话“#define SW_BREAKPOINT asm( " SWBP 0" );”这是什么意思啊?SWBP我查不到这句汇编的意思。
lizye 发表于 2017-12-17 16:21 | 显示全部楼层

没有注释吗?
jiahy 发表于 2017-12-17 16:24 | 显示全部楼层
 楼主| shimx 发表于 2017-12-17 16:26 | 显示全部楼层

这句话上面的注释是“ Software Breakpoint code
Uses inline assembly command ”
lizye 发表于 2017-12-17 16:27 | 显示全部楼层
这个是个宏定义啊,用NOP1代表asm{NOP 1},asm代表后面的是汇编指令,{NOP 1}代表执行空指令。
 楼主| shimx 发表于 2017-12-17 16:30 | 显示全部楼层
还有呢
jiaxw 发表于 2017-12-17 16:32 | 显示全部楼层
具体汇编指令什么意思,可以查看数据手册。
lizye 发表于 2017-12-17 16:33 | 显示全部楼层

不知道了。。
 楼主| shimx 发表于 2017-12-17 16:35 | 显示全部楼层
我也知道是个宏定义,但就是不知道是什么意义
spark周 发表于 2017-12-17 16:38 | 显示全部楼层

那就不晓得了
spark周 发表于 2017-12-17 16:40 | 显示全部楼层

这个是不是写错的了呢?
 楼主| shimx 发表于 2017-12-17 16:42 | 显示全部楼层
好吧,结贴了
firstblood 发表于 2017-12-18 22:08 | 显示全部楼层
这个是不是写错了?汇编里面我也没有查到的
10299823 发表于 2017-12-20 15:44 | 显示全部楼层
SW_BREAKPOINT 断点/
jimmhu 发表于 2017-12-20 15:45 | 显示全部楼层
汇编语言指令集合有吗
lihuami 发表于 2017-12-20 15:45 | 显示全部楼层
没有用到过这个指令。
houjiakai 发表于 2017-12-20 15:46 | 显示全部楼层
lizye 发表于 2017-12-17 16:27
这个是个宏定义啊,用NOP1代表asm{NOP 1},asm代表后面的是汇编指令,{NOP 1}代表执行空指令。
...

这个不是空指令把。
10299823 发表于 2017-12-20 15:49 | 显示全部楼层
这个代码出现在哪里?
jimmhu 发表于 2017-12-20 15:49 | 显示全部楼层
是CMPSW这个吗?
lihuami 发表于 2017-12-20 15:49 | 显示全部楼层
楼主能够把整个代码粘贴一下吗
您需要登录后才可以回帖 登录 | 注册

本版积分规则

857

主题

10661

帖子

5

粉丝
快速回复 在线客服 返回列表 返回顶部